#7bcd88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bcd88 is composed of 48.2% red, 80.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.7%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 129.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.1% and a lightness of 64.3%. #7bcd88 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#009b11.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#7bcd88 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#7bcd88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bcd88 has RGB values of R:123, G:205,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 8113544.

Shades and Tints of #7bcd88
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a05 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bcd88
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9eaaa0 is the less saturated color, while #4afe67 is the most saturated one.
